Transaction 51f76ddf987108a2aa54de9da35c179d054dbf353d2cfe45fdd847042590504c

2 Input
2 Outputs
  • 51f76ddf987108a2aa54de9da35c179d054dbf353d2cfe45fdd847042590504c:0
  • value  2305387
    address  3KabDav2h3YXTALoFWb2mQ4kEfeatyAcVp
  • 51f76ddf987108a2aa54de9da35c179d054dbf353d2cfe45fdd847042590504c:1
  • value  1000663
    address  3Ls8DVuiY8iqarV7eBwJtgZo4M5HN6L4Nq